Washing Hands Frequently: Hygienic habits is one of the best tips and tricks your child should receive from any health and hygiene lesson. They should know the significance of washing hands and maintaining hygiene. Most of the time, you must remember how busy your hands are during the day. For example, if you are a homemaker, you probably work the whole day, like opening and shutting doors, cleaning the toilet, and brushing your tablet or phone. Every exercise that requires hands is another way of spreading germs, viruses, and other harmful bacteria. And this is the reason you should ask your children to wash their hands with Namaah Antibacterial Hand Wash every time they visit the bathroom, before and after their snacks, and while playing outdoors. Following this step would considerably reduce the risk of germs, viruses, and bacteria getting spread.

Clean up after going toilet: Today, many children worldwide face difficulty while trying to master this particular step. Make your child comfortable while teaching these basic things, and it’s essential for your child not to get embarrassed while learning it. Educate them about how to manage water, using tissue paper and hand washes to clean themselves thoroughly. Never try to act disgusted or confused when you are teaching your children. You are making them unhealthy and unhygienic. If you look ashamed, your child will be too and be forced to skip this step.

Smile and show it: Make sure to assist your children with brushing their teeth originally and ultimately let them do it by themselves throughout the age of five or six. Educate them with the proper guidance and the right amount of time to brush with the help of a song or a short story. Moreover, teach your elder ones how to floss and use the necessary mouthwash. Even when your children have baby teeth, teaching them about the significance of brushing at an early age will improve healthy habits for life.
